The Council of Europe is an International Organisation headquartered in
Strasbourg, which comprises 47 countries of Europe. It was set up to
promote democracy and protect Human Rights and the rule of law in
Europe.
The Committee on Social Affairs, Health, and Sustainable Development
is part of the Parliamentary Assembly of the Council of Europe
(PACE).
The Committee considers issues relating to social rights and policies,
public health, sustainable development, economic cooperation and
development, local and regional democracy, and good governance in
these fields, having special regard to the situation of the more vulnerable
groups in society.
The Committee is also responsible for inter alia awarding the Europe
Prize (created in 1955) which recognises the contribution made by
towns and cities towards the promotion of the European ideal. For

The tasks of the Trainee include inter alia:
- Conducting documentary and legal research for information;
- Drafting elements to support the work of rapporteurs on various
reports;
- Assisting various activities of the Committee on Social Affairs, Health
and Sustainable Development in the run-up to and during Assembly
sessions (e.g. in connection to the Europe Prize, awareness-raising
campaigns, etc.).
